The Technical Brilliance:

Shankar-Ehsaan-Loy’s music is the soul of the film. The track "Maa" is guaranteed to leave you in tears, perfectly capturing the agonizing separation of a child from his mother. The cinematography captures the stark, grey rigidity of the boarding school in brilliant contrast to the vibrant, kinetic colors of Ishaan’s imagination.
